There were 25 companies in cities associated with Clark County that received FDA citations as a result of 25 inspections conducted in the county in 2025, according to the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A).

This is a 66.7% increase over the number of companies cited in the previous year.

Of the 66 citations issued, the most common citation was ‘You did not establish product specifications for identity, purity, strength, composition and limits on contamination’.

Most of the companies cited were involved in the Food and Cosmetics sector. The second most common type of company operated in either Drugs or Biologics sectors.

Of the companies cited, 21 should take voluntary actions to correct their managing operations (84%). Additionally, four companies had to take regulatory and/or administrative actions (16%).

The FDA routinely inspects facilities across the nation to determine if the workplace and their products are compliant with FDA-regulated laws and regulations implemented to improve overall public health. Inspection results are then disclosed publicly.

According to its website, the FDA is a government agency that is primarily responsible for monitoring the production and distribution of human and animal drugs, biological products, medical supplies and tobacco products for safety and quality.
